How to Calculate 12×14 in Square Feet
To find how many square feet is 12×14, we use a very simple formula:
Area Formula:
Length × Width = Area (Square Feet)
Now apply the values:
- Length = 12 feet
- Width = 14 feet
So: 12 × 14 = 168
Final Answer
A 12×14 room is:
168 square feet
This means the total floor space inside a 12 by 14 room covers 168 square feet.

12×14 in Square Meters (Metric Conversion)
In many countries, square meters are used instead of square feet.
Conversion formula:
- 1 square foot = 0.0929 square meters
Now calculate:
- 168 × 0.0929 = 15.61 square meters (approx.)
So:
12×14 room = approximately 15.6 m²

Comparison With Other Room Sizes
To better understand how big 12×14 is, let’s compare it with other common room sizes:
| Room Size | Square Feet | Description |
|---|---|---|
| 10×10 | 100 sq ft | Very small room |
| 12×12 | 144 sq ft | Compact bedroom |
| 12×14 | 168 sq ft | Medium-small room |
| 14×16 | 224 sq ft | Comfortable bedroom |
| 16×20 | 320 sq ft | Large room |
From this comparison, you can see that 12×14 sits in the middle range of small to medium rooms.

1. Flooring planning
If you are installing tiles, wood, or carpet, you must know the exact area.
For a 12×14 room:
- Total area = 168 sq ft
- Add 5–10% extra for waste and cutting
So you may need:
- Around 175–185 sq ft of material
This avoids shortage during installation.

Common Mistakes When Calculating Square Feet
Many people make mistakes while measuring rooms. Here are the most common ones:
1. Confusing units
Some people mix:
- Feet and inches
- Feet and meters
This leads to incorrect results.
Always confirm the unit before calculating.
2. Ignoring irregular shapes
Not all rooms are perfect rectangles. If a room has:
- A corner extension
- A closet space
- A bathroom attached
You must measure each section separately.
3. Not measuring properly
Guessing room size instead of using a tape measure often leads to:
- Wrong flooring orders
- Wasted money
- Poor furniture fit
4. Forgetting extra material allowance
For flooring or tiling, always add extra material:
- 5% to 10% for waste and cutting
